With Google Play For Education, Google Looks To Challenge Apple's Dominance In The Clas... - 1 views

  • Google Play for Education,
  • aims to simplify the content discovery process for schools,
  • the real key to Google’s new product is the fact that it enables administrators to distribute applications to their entire team. If a teacher wants to shoot content to a couple hundred Android devices, they simply have to type in their group’s name and voila, Google will push that sucker out to everyone on the list.
  • ...3 more annotations...
  • Teachers will now be able to search for and recommend learning content by category, grade level, and a variety of other criteria, and will have the opportunity to discover content recommended by other educators
  • mall businesses have been adopting Google’s productivity software in droves, and the interest has started to grow among school boards who want to introduce tablets into their classrooms and use Google Apps as the standard.
  • Through its Google Apps products, Google allows students and teachers to collaborate in realtime through Web apps, while using already-familiar tools like Google search and Gmail.
  •  
    Google Play for Education is not just a new search engine.  Google is poising itself to compete with Apple in the Education market.  Really like that apps can be pushed out across multiple devices with one click.

Transforming American Education: Learning Powered by Technology - 0 views

  •  
    This is the 2010 National Education Technology Plan summary.  While very broad, it does "Encourage states, districts, P-12 programs, and postsecondary education institutions to experiment with such resources as online learning, online tutoring and mentoring, games,  cognitive tutors, immersive environments, and participatory communities and social networks both within and across education institutions to give students guidance and  information about their own learning progress and strategies for seamless completion of a comprehensive P-16 education."
